Take your study abroad experience beyond the classroom through the CIEE Community Impact Initiative. Connect with your host community, make a meaningful difference, and build skills that help you grow as an individual by serving others in three ways:

  • Community Impact Orientation: Kick off your CIEE program by meeting local community partners during your first week abroad. Get to know your new community and make an impact through weekly service work projects. 
  • Community Impact Week: Celebrate the difference you’re making alongside fellow students and local organizations. Share your experiences, reflect on what you’ve learned, and recognize the impact of your service projects within the community. 
  • Community Impact Global Poster Competition: Turn your experience into a story worth telling. Reflect on the achievements and lessons from your service work by creating a poster that showcases your impact abroad. Compete for the opportunity to present at the annual CIEE Study Abroad Conference and help secure a CIEE donation for your community partner!

Food Security

  • Collect surplus food and redistribute it to families in need through ReFood in Lisbon 
  • Prepare nutritious food, promote sustainability, and combat food waste through Our Big Kitchen in Syndey 
  • Distribute meals while supporting educational initiatives for youth with Ladles of Love in Cape Town

Community Development + Public Health

  • Restore historic neighborhoods and public parks in partnership with Retake Rome 
  • Care for seniors and families in vulnerable situations at Fundació Roure in Barcelona 
  • Support community clean-up initiatives and sustainability practices with Tokyo River Friends in Tokyo

Youth Development + Education

  • Promote literacy, educational access, and social inclusion through the Seongbok Braille Library in Seoul 
  • Provide mentorship and study support to children and teenagers through Mais Skillz in Lisbon 
  • Support vulnerable groups by providing recreational activities through Darsena Deportiva in Seville 

Community Impact Week

monteverde-ccii-female-student-pushing-wheelbarrow-on-farm

Every spring and fall semester, each of CIEE’s 45+ global centers hosts a week-long celebration highlighting the impact you and your peers are making in your host city.  

During Community Impact Week, you’ll:  

  • Share what your community needs and how you’ve helped to make a difference
  • Celebrate the connections you’ve built all semester
  • See your stories shared online so the whole CIEE network can celebrate the work you and local partners are doing  

It’s all about showing up, giving back, and recognizing the community impact you’re making abroad!

CIEE Community Impact Global Poster Competition

Each year, CIEE hosts the Community Impact Global Poster Competition – a chance for you to highlight the service project you’ve worked on abroad and represent your region at the next annual CIEE Study Abroad Conference.  

One finalist from each CIEE region will:  

  • Travel to the conference’s host city (round-trip airfare and lodging provided)  
  • Present their project on an international stage  
  • Compete for awards  
  • Earn a CIEE donation for their community organization – helping your impact continue long after you’ve returned home
